启动失败通常由以下原因导致:
- 依赖未完整安装: Run
npm install
时网络中断可能导致包缺失。解决方案:删除node_modules
文件夹后重新安装。 - API密钥未配置If
.env.local
中未添加有效的OpenAI等密钥,服务可能无法启动。需检查文件路径和密钥格式。 - port occupancy:默认3000端口可能被其他程序占用。可通过
npm run dev -- --port 3001
更换端口。 - Node.js版本过低:需确保版本≥v16,否则部分依赖无法兼容。
若上述方法无效,建议查看命令行报错日志,或在GitHub仓库的Issue区搜索类似问题。
This answer comes from the articleZola: Open Source AI Chat Web App with Document Upload and Multi-Model SupportThe